我目前正在linux中编写程序:从命令行我执行以下步骤:
$ touch project.java $ nano project.java
我写了代码。
我有疑问:如何创建新的类,接口等?因为在像Betbeans这样的IDE中,我可以右键单击项目名称并选择“创建新类”或“创建新界面”并创建它但是如果我不使用IDE,它在Linux中是如何实现的?
答案 0 :(得分:4)
如果你不使用IDE,你自己键入所有内容,使用命令行编辑器 - emacs,vi或nano,就像你之前使用的一样。 (或CAT >>
为严肃的职业选手)。
接口如下所示:(Read Java Sun's tutorial for more about Interfaces!)
interface Bicycle {
void changeCadence(int newValue); // wheel revolutions per minute
}
类看起来像这样(Read Java Sun's tutorial for more about Classes!):
class Bicycle {
int cadence = 0;
void changeCadence(int newValue) {
cadence = newValue;
}
}
等等,这些都在文档中。继续阅读Java的方便教程,你会发现它。
答案 1 :(得分:2)
如果你想避免使用IDE,那么当前的方法是有效的(除了touch
是不必要的)。
只需自己输入完整的源代码即可。
例如,要创建名为Foo
的类,请使用首选编辑器并使用以下内容编辑文件Foo.java
:
public class Foo {
}
保存并编译完成。